We're all off to sunny Spain once again after the Covid-19 travel ban was lifted. And the Daily Mirror was on board the first plane out of the UK heading to the Costas today.

Excited sun-seekers and expats joined the early morning flight from Manchester to Alicante. Colleen Pitchford, 74, who retired and moved to Mazarron, Murcia, seven years ago, had flown back to the UK in early March to watch her beloved Liverpool play Atletico Madrid in the Champions League.

But five days later Spain was in lockdown and she could not return. After more than three months away, she was in tears as she landed at Alicante.

She said: “I got the first available flight. I could not wait to get back home. I’m looking forward to having lunch later with a friend
